Senior game designer Daniel Holt explained that the decision to have each deck themed around one game allowed the team to "dive deep into the lore of each, capturing even more beloved moments from across the games storyline." When asked exactly how Wizards of the Coast came to choose the games that would be included in the crossover (I'm slightly disappointed Final Fantasy 9 didn't make the cut), Holt explained that Final Fantasy 7 and 14 were the clear picks due to their popularity, but that Final Fantasy 6 and 10 were chosen partially due to how many fans of those games were among the Wizards of the Coast team
